【发布时间】:2016-09-26 07:17:47
【问题描述】:
当/prco/sys/random/entropy_avail 减少时,我想不断增加它。
我先检查rngd(https://wiki.archlinux.org/index.php/Rng-tools)
它说/dev/random 非常慢,因为它只从设备驱动程序和其他(慢)源收集熵,我认为这就是我们使用rngd 的原因。
它说rngd 主要使用硬件随机数生成器 (TRNG),存在于现代硬件中,例如最近的 AMD/Intel 处理器、VIA Nano 甚至 Raspberry Pi。
但是,当我开始 rngd 时,它会说
[root@localhost init.d]# rngd
can't open entropy source(tpm or intel/amd rng)
Maybe RNG device modules are not loaded
但是我没有cat /proc/cpuinfo | grep rdrand 确认的 Intel RDRAND:
[root@localhost init.d]# cat /proc/cpuinfo | grep rdrand | wc -l
0
如果有任何可能的资源我可以使用?
或者,是否可以使脚本增加/proc/sys/random/entropy_avail?
【问题讨论】:
标签: linux random linux-kernel cryptography